Wagering Requirements Explained
Wagering requirements determine how many times the bonus must be played before winnings become withdrawable.
For example:
A$75 bonus × 30x wagering = A$2,250 total wagering requirement
Only after this threshold is reached can eligible winnings be withdrawn.
Game contribution often varies:
• Video Slots: 100% contribution
• Table games: 10–20%
• Live dealer: partial contribution
• Some specialty Games: excluded
Contribution weighting protects the operator from arbitrage strategies.

Fraud Controls That Shape Eligibility
No deposit promotions are the most targeted incentive type for abuse. As a result, Lucky Green Casino-style campaigns typically run behind multiple automated checks that operate before credit issuance and again before withdrawals.
Signals that can trigger review include device fingerprint repetition, mismatched location signals, rapid multi-account patterns, shared payment identifiers (even if no deposit is required, later steps can expose payment overlaps), and abnormal gameplay behavior immediately after credit appears. These controls exist to keep campaigns viable for genuine users, because without them the offers would either disappear or become so restrictive that they would be functionally unusable.
A practical implication is that accuracy and consistency in account data matters. When players enter clean, verifiable information and avoid duplicate-account behavior, they reduce the probability of delays.
Wagering Contribution Weighting and Why It Exists
Contribution rules are designed to prevent mathematical exploitation. Titles with a low house edge or stable return profile are typically weighted down, while higher variance, entertainment-focused titles are weighted fully. This is why video slot play commonly contributes at full rate while some table formats contribute only partially or not at all.
The key point for players is that “wagering requirement” is not a single number; it is a number filtered by what you played. Two users can wager the same amount and reach different progress if they used different eligible titles.
Withdrawal Pathway Controls
Even if wagering is completed, no deposit winnings usually move through a second gate: payout compliance. That stage commonly includes identity verification completion, ownership validation for the chosen payout method, and basic integrity checks on play history. These procedures are not unique to one casino brand; they are standard practice for any operator trying to keep payment processors stable and regulators satisfied.
Players can reduce friction by keeping documents ready, submitting clear images, and making sure the name on the account aligns with the submitted ID. The most common causes of delays are not “refusals,” but incomplete documentation, mismatched details, or attempting to cash out through methods that cannot be verified reliably.
